What is the definition of an unstable parent?

Jan 12, 2024

The term “unstable parent” can have various interpretations, but generally, it refers to a parent who may struggle with providing a consistent, safe, and nurturing environment for their child. This could be due to various reasons such as mental health issues, substance abuse, financial instability, or other personal challenges. In the context of New York, the implications for a child’s well-being are significant, as an unstable parental environment can impact a child’s emotional, physical, and mental development.

Characteristics of an Unstable Parent

An unstable parent often exhibits mental health issues, substance abuse, erratic behavior, inability to meet children’s basic needs, and financial or legal troubles, affecting their capacity to provide a stable environment for their child. Here are examples of an unstable parent characteristics:

  1. Mental Health Issues: A key characteristic of an unstable parent is the presence of untreated or poorly managed mental health conditions, which can impact their ability to care for their children effectively.
  2. Substance Abuse: Substance abuse problems significantly contribute to parental instability. This not only affects the parent’s judgment and behavior but also puts the child in potential harm.
  3. Erratic or Dangerous Behavior: Unstable parents may exhibit erratic or dangerous behavior, such as neglect, abuse, or creating an unsafe living environment.
  4. Inconsistency in Providing Basic Needs: Inability to consistently provide for the child’s basic needs, including food, shelter, and emotional support, is another indicator of instability.
  5. Legal and Financial Issues: Ongoing legal troubles or financial instability can also be factors that contribute to a parent being considered unstable.
